Intershop on the future of B2B commerce

6 digital trends transforming 2026

Intershop recently published its Digital Trends Report 2026, offering a look ahead at the technological shifts that will reshape the B2B landscape in the coming years. From AI purchasing agents to data unlocking new revenue streams, the report highlights how rapidly digital transformation is accelerating.

From searching to asking

The classic search engine is losing ground. By 2026, more and more B2B buyers will rely on AI tools like ChatGPT, Copilot, and Gemini to get direct answers instead of browsing through search results.

This shift is transforming SEO into A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) and GEO (Generative Engine Optimization), new approaches that make your content discoverable and understandable for AI models.

➡️ What this means for B2B companies: Rich, structured product data and clear content are becoming mission-critical. Businesses that invest now in well-structured data feeds, detailed FAQs, and transparent documentation will stay visible in a world where AI becomes the new gateway to information.

AI agents start buying on their own

According to Intershop, 2026 will mark the rise of “agentic commerce.” Smart AI agents will independently make purchases within predefined parameters, handling repeat orders, spare parts, and consumables without human input.

Humans won’t disappear from the process, but AI will take over repetitive, low-value tasks, freeing teams to focus on strategy and innovation.

Companies that prepare their platforms with accessible APIs, structured data (Schema.org, JSON-LD), and clear business rules will be ready for the next phase of B2B automation.

Every salesperson gets a digital wingman

AI isn’t just empowering buyers, it’s transforming the role of sales teams, too. Sellers now have their own digital copilots that analyze data, summarize customer insights, draft proposals, and even suggest new campaign ideas.

With tools like Intershop Copilot for Buyers, customers can find what they need faster, while sales teams save time, communicate more effectively, and make smarter decisions.

According to Gartner, by 2028, 60% of all B2B sales interactions will take place through generative AI interfaces, a massive leap from just 5% in 2023.

From operations to strategy

As AI agents and copilots take over repetitive tasks, the role of e-commerce managers is evolving, from operational to strategic.

Instead of manually building dashboards, managers will guide AI-driven systems that automatically spot trends, perform market analyses, and suggest next steps.

The focus shifts toward vision, change management, and cross-department collaboration between marketing, IT, and customer service.

Adopting AI isn’t just a technological shift, it’s an organizational transformation. The most successful companies are already preparing their teams today for this next phase.

Exploring new markets becomes easier than ever

Geopolitical tensions and nearshoring trends are reshaping global supply chains. At the same time, AI makes it faster and easier to test new markets. Automatically translating content, powering multilingual copilots for local customer service, and delivering real-time market insights.

This allows companies to explore new regions before establishing a local presence. Intershop predicts that these AI-driven market entries will soon become the norm. Faster, more cost-effective, and far less risky.

Data becomes the new revenue stream

B2B companies are sitting on vast amounts of valuable data, from purchase histories and service logs to machine performance metrics. Now, AI makes it possible to turn that data into predictive services and entirely new sources of revenue.

Intershop highlights an inspiring example from our customer Huisman, where the myHuisman portal uses real-time data to predict maintenance needs, offer spare parts proactively, and support customers before issues arise.

This marks a shift from selling products to offering data-driven services, creating new value for customers.
